In this episode of the Inclusive Pathways Podcast, host Jessica Winchester chats with Michael Grimmett, disability advocate and creator of Comments Disabled, for a meaningful conversation about leadership, lived experience, and the future of disability inclusion.

Michael shares his journey as a disabled professional and advocate, reflecting on what he’s learned from working alongside and being led by other disabled leaders. Together, Jessica and Michael explore how authentic representation in leadership is essential.

They dive into:
  • Why disability representation in leadership changes how organizations think and act
  • How lived experience creates better decision-making and innovation
  • The importance of accessibility as a leadership mindset
  • What inclusive leadership really looks like in practice
  • How small, consistent changes can shift culture from awareness to accountability
Michael reminds us that when disabled people lead, inclusion stops being a checkbox and becomes a catalyst for change.
